Colleja colorada; Catchfly

Silene colorata

Description:

Small wildflower that is eatable, either raw in saldas or cokked, although it is not so commonly consumed as the bladder campion (Silene vulgaris).

Habitat:

Meadows in an evergreen oak forest. Dehesa de Valdelatas
